在当今数字化时代,互联网已成为我们生活不可或缺的一部分,从社交媒体到在线购物,从远程工作到在线教育,几乎所有的在线活动都依赖于一个核心组件——Web服务器,但究竟什么是Web服务器?它是如何工作的?为什么它对现代世界如此重要?本文将深入探讨这些关键问题,揭示Web服务器背后的奥秘。
Web服务器是一种软件或硬件设备,用于存储、处理和传递网页内容给客户端(通常是网络浏览器),当您在浏览器中输入网址并按下回车键时,您的请求被发送到托管该网站的服务器,服务器接收到请求后,会检索相应的网页文件并将其发送回您的浏览器,浏览器随后将这些信息渲染成您看到的网站页面。
1、内容托管:Web服务器最基本的职责是存储构成网站的各种文件,包括HTML文档、图片、视频、CSS样式表以及JavaScript脚本等。
2、请求响应机制:每当有用户尝试访问网站时,Web服务器都会响应这些请求,它会根据请求的URL找到对应的资源,并将其作为HTTP响应返回给用户的浏览器。
3、生成:许多现代网站使用服务器端编程语言(如PHP、ASP.NET或Java)来动态生成内容,这意味着每次用户访问时,服务器都会根据特定条件(如用户身份验证状态或数据库查询结果)实时创建页面内容。
4、安全性管理:Web服务器负责实施安全措施,保护网站免受攻击,这包括使用SSL/TLS加密通信、设置访问控制列表(ACLs)、防止跨站脚本攻击(XSS)和SQL注入等。
5、负载均衡与可扩展性:对于高流量的网站,单个服务器可能无法处理所有的请求,Web服务器通常与其他服务器协同工作,通过负载均衡技术分散请求,确保服务的连续性和性能。
市场上有多种不同的Web服务器软件可供选择,每种都有其独特的特点和优势,以下是一些最流行的选项:
Apache HTTP Server:以其稳定性和高度可配置性著称,是全球使用最广泛的Web服务器之一。
Nginx:以其轻量级设计、高性能和优秀的反向代理能力而闻名,特别适合处理大量并发连接。
Microsoft IIS:主要在Windows服务器上运行,提供了丰富的集成服务,如ASP.NET支持。
Tomcat:虽然不是传统意义上的Web服务器,但它是一个广泛使用的Java应用服务器,可以处理基于Java的Web应用程序。
在数字世界中,Web服务器扮演着至关重要的角色,它们是企业展示产品和服务、个人分享信息、教育者和学生进行远程教学、以及政府提供服务的主要平台,没有Web服务器,现代互联网经济和社会互动将无法存在。
随着云计算、人工智能和物联网技术的发展,Web服务器领域也在不断进步,未来的Web服务器可能会更加智能化,能够自动优化性能、增强安全性,并通过机器学习算法预测和管理流量模式,边缘计算的兴起意味着更多的数据处理将在离用户更近的地方进行,这将要求Web服务器具备更高的灵活性和分布式处理能力。
Web服务器是连接用户与数字世界的桥梁,它们不仅支撑着当前的互联网生态,还在不断进化以满足未来的挑战,无论是简单的个人博客还是复杂的电子商务平台,背后都有一个或多个Web服务器在默默工作,确保信息流动畅通无阻。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态